Pet's info: Dog | Mixed Breed Medium (23 - 60lb) | Male | neutered | 10 months old | 60 lbs
We have around a 9 or 10th month old dog. Since he was around 4 months or so we have been swapping dog sitting duties with my father in law , who has a 9 year old golden ret. recently my 9 month old started biting and holding the back of the Holden's neck whenever they go to leave a room, and has been generally more aggressive. What should we do? Is this going to keep being a problem? If he is trying to show dominance, are my kids safe?

It does sound like from your descriptions that Graham is starting to act a little aggressive, and I would take him into a professional behavioral expert as soon as possible for training. I never recommend owners try to train aggressive dogs themselves because it can be dangerous, so it's best left to a professional. Aggressive behavior can escalate, and it can continue to be a problem. Without seeing his behaviors in person, I can't say for sure if your kids are safe around him, but I would not leave him unsupervised with them just to be cautious. I would speak to your vet first thing in the morning about a referral to a behavioral expert.
